22 Mayıs 2014 Perşembe

Where Deyimi



WHERE DEYİMİ

Bir koşulu belirterek sadece o koşula uyan kayıtların seçilmesini sağlar. Şartlı ifadeler belirlemek için kullanılır.


WHERE koşulunda kullanılabilecek operatörler şunlardır:


=         eşittir
>         büyüktür
<          küçüktür
>=       büyük veya eşittir
<=       küçük veya eşittir
< >       eşit değildir

BETWEEN/NOT BETWEEN     à        Aralık belirtmede kullanılır.
IN ve NOT IN                            à        Listelemek için kullanılır.
LIKE ve NOT LIKE                    à        String karşılaştırmada kullanılır.
AND, OR                                 à        Koşulların birleştirilmesinde kullanılır
NOT                                        à        Olumsuzlaştırmada kullanılır.


Kullanımı: 


select <alanadi> from <tabloadi>

where <alanadi> <operatörler><deger>

                       select * from ogrenci

where adi='Merve'

Adı Merve olanları gösterdi.
                       



                       select * from ogrenci

where okulno between 1110 and 1150

                      Okulno su 1110 ile 1150 arasında olanları gösterdi.




                      select * from ogrenci
where adi='Merve' or soyadi='Şimşek'

           Adı Merve olanları gösterip daha sonra Soyadı Şimşek olanları                           gösterdi.
                       



            select * from ogrenci
where adi='Merve' and soyadi='Altuntaş'

 
Adı Merve ve Soyadı Altuntaş olan kaydı gösterdi. Yani iki koşulu da sağlayanları gösterdi. 





Hiç yorum yok:

Yorum Gönder